The second phase of the Janatha Vimukthi Peramuna (JVP)'s protest walk against the government will begin from Moratuwa today (Jul 8).
Protestors will then conclude their march in Nugegoda at which a party rally would be held afterwards.
The JVP had organised this protest calling for the resignation of the government over their failure to provide security to the people.
The first stage of the march began in Kalutara and ended in Moratuwa yesterday.
